Law Elected President of Iowa State Bar Association


June 25, 2025

Nyemaster Goode attorney Kathleen K. Law, a member of the firm’s Business, Finance, and Real Estate practice, has been elected the 2025-2026 President of the Iowa State Bar Association. Law was installed at the ISBA Annual Meeting on June 25, 2025.

 

The Iowa State Bar Association is the oldest voluntary state bar association in the United States and represents approximately 6,500 lawyers and judges licensed to practice law in the state of Iowa. The ISBA facilitates professional growth and collegiality among Iowa attorneys. Its mission is to support members and their service to clients, community, and the judicial system.

 

Law is a prominent wind and solar energy development attorney and maintains a practice representing developers of alternative energy projects, as well as a significant traditional commercial real estate development practice. She is a past member of the ISBA’s Board of Governors and has past service with the ISBA’s Business Law Council, Real Estate Section Council, and Title Standards Committee.  Law also has served as co-chair of the ISBA Annual Meeting Committee and is a past chair of the ISBA’s Well-being and Legal Forms committees. She has also served on the State Judicial Nominating Commission and is a past member of the Drake Law School Board of Counselors. She also serves as an adjunct professor teaching Real Estate Transactions at Drake University Law School.
